Classic Thanksgiving Turkey Recipes
There are many classic turkey recipes for a homemade dinner. These dishes are great for family gatherings and need just a few ingredients. You can choose from traditional roasted turkey or try something new.
Some popular classic Thanksgiving turkey recipes include:
- Herb-roasted turkey, which is made by rubbing the turkey with a mixture of herbs and spices before roasting
- Deep-fried turkey, which is made by frying the turkey in hot oil to create a crispy exterior and juicy interior
- Spatchcock turkey, which is made by removing the backbone and flattening the turkey before roasting

Mouthwatering Turkey Marinades
A good marinade can change the flavor and tenderness of your turkey. For family-friendly turkey recipes, try a citrus herb or teriyaki marinade. These are easy to make and need just a few ingredients.
Some popular marinade options for turkey include:
- Citrus herb marinade, made with lemon juice, olive oil, and herbs like thyme and rosemary
- Teriyaki marinade, made with soy sauce, brown sugar, and ginger
These marinades make delicious and flavorful turkey dishes. They’re great for any occasion.
For a truly mouthwatering turkey, marinate it for at least 24 hours. This lets the flavors soak deep into the meat. With these marinades and a bit of patience, you’ll impress your family and friends with the best turkey recipes.

Stuffing and Side Dishes
Stuffing and side dishes are key to a great homemade turkey dinner. Options like traditional bread stuffing, quinoa stuffing with cranberries, and roasted veggies are excellent. For a healthier choice, use fresh herbs and veggies in your stuffing. Choose roasted or grilled sides over fried ones.
Popular sides for turkey include mashed potatoes, green bean casserole, and sweet potato casserole. These dishes are easy to make and can be prepared ahead of time. For a healthier option, try roasted Brussels sprouts or carrots with herbs.
Here are some tips for making the perfect stuffing and side dishes:
- Use fresh, high-quality ingredients for the best flavor.
- Avoid overstuffing the turkey to prevent uneven cooking and food safety issues.
- Make a few different side dishes to offer variety for your guests.
